After a shutout win over a FCS cupcake in week 1, Western Kentucky went into Tuscaloosa with dreams of pulling off the upset over #9 Alabama. The key to this game was Alabama HB Eddie Lacy, plus a couple of deep Bama passes. Every time the Hilltoppers had Bama stopped on 3rd and long, Lacy would start breaking tackles. He had 20 carries for 92 yards and broke 9 tackles. WKU had a solid 1st half, going into the break down 17-12. QB Kawaun Jakes was 9/15 for 150 yards at the time... however, the Hilltoppers got desperate in the 2nd half and went to the pass too often. Jakes ended the day 15/33 for 299 yards and 1 crucial INT, and he also ran the ball 9 times for 31 yards and both of the Hilltoppers TD's. Across the sideline, Bama QB AJ McCarron went 13/23 for 287 yards, 1td and 2int's. In the end, Western Kentucky fell to Alabama, 24-18.
